Cracks wide open in Punjab Congress as Channi camp skips Baghel’s outreach meetings

Internal tensions in the Punjab Congress have surfaced as senior leaders Charanjit Singh Channi and Sukhjinder Singh Randhawa skipped outreach meetings led by Bhupesh Baghel. The party is currently navigating leadership dissatisfaction following a recent organizational revamp.
Congress’s Punjab in-charge Bhupesh Baghel on Tuesday met several State leaders even as a section of disgruntled leaders reportedly camped in New Delhi to press for a meeting with the party’s central leadership amid the ongoing infighting within the State unit. Former Chief Minister Charanjit Singh Channi and MP Sukhjinder Singh Randhawa were conspicuous by their absence from meetings convened by Mr. Baghel.
